The American Water Spaniel is a breed that originated in the United States, specifically in Wisconsin. It was developed as a hunting dog that could work both on land and in water. The breed is known for its keen sense of smell, strong retrieving instincts, and high energy levels.
The Bedlington Terrier, on the other hand, has its origins in England. It was originally bred as a fighting dog but has since been inbred to be a companion dog. The breed is known for its unique appearance, with its lamb-like curly coat and distinctive head shape.

One thing to note about this crossbreed is that they require a lot of exercise. Both the American Water Spaniel and Bedlington Terrier have high energy levels, so it is important to provide them with plenty of opportunities to run and play. They also require mental stimulation, so activities like puzzle toys and agility training are highly recommended.
In terms of appearance, the crossbreed of American Water Spaniel and Bedlington Terrier can vary. They may inherit the curly coat of the Bedlington Terrier or the wavy coat of the American Water Spaniel. Their size also varies, with some dogs being on the smaller side while others may be medium-sized.
When it comes to temperament, the crossbreed of American Water Spaniel and Bedlington Terrier is known to be affectionate and loyal. They are great with families and make excellent companions. They are also highly trainable and eager to please, making them great candidates for obedience training.
